Firmenlogo

Dev-ops Engineer at Bright

Bright · Belfast, United Kingdom · Hybrid

Apply Now
Who are we? 
At Bright, we're creating cutting-edge software for accounting, payroll, tax, and practice management. We've assembled a team of top talent leading the industry with our superior software solutions and unparalleled customer support. We're brilliant people creating brilliant software! Join us in our mission to create brilliant software that empowers businesses to reach new heights. 


The Opportunity 
As a DevOps Engineer at Bright, you'll be enabling our engineering teams to build, deploy, and operate production systems at scale. You'll support the infrastructure and deployment pipelines for our API platform and product development teams, ensuring they can ship fast, safely, and reliably to tens of thousands of customers across the UK and Ireland. 
Working across our Azure-based Kubernetes infrastructure, you'll build and maintain the CI/CD pipelines, infrastructure as code, and observability systems that enable small, autonomous squads to deploy with confidence. You'll be instrumental in creating the foundations that allow our teams to move at startup pace while maintaining production reliability and security. 





Key Responsibilities

Key Responsibilities 
Infrastructure & Platform 
  • Build and maintain Kubernetes infrastructure on Azure (AKS) for production workloads 
  • Implement infrastructure as code using Terraform for consistent, repeatable deployments 
  • Design and optimize cloud architecture for performance, cost, and reliability 
  • Manage container orchestration, networking, and storage solutions 
  • Ensure high availability and disaster recovery capabilities 
CI/CD & Deployment 
  • Build and maintain CI/CD pipelines using ArgoCD and GitOps workflows 
  • Enable fast, safe deployments for multiple engineering teams 
  • Implement automated testing, security scanning, and quality gates 
  • Create deployment strategies (blue/green, canary, rolling updates) 
  • Support teams with deployment tooling and best practices 
Observability & Reliability 
  • Implement comprehensive monitoring, logging, and alerting systems 
  • Build dashboards and metrics for system health and performance 
  • Design and implement incident response procedures 
  • Conduct post-mortems and drive continuous improvement 
  • Optimize system performance and resource utilization 
Security & Compliance 
  • Implement security best practices across infrastructure and deployments 
  • Manage secrets, credentials, and access control 
  • Ensure compliance with data protection requirements for financial data 
  • Conduct security scanning and vulnerability management 
  • Support audit and compliance requirements 
Collaboration & Enablement 
  • Work closely with engineering teams to understand deployment needs 
  • Provide guidance on containerization and cloud-native practices 
  • Document infrastructure, runbooks, and troubleshooting guides 
  • Participate in on-call rotation for production systems 
  • Mentor team members on DevOps practices and tooling 

Skills, Knowledge and Expertise

Essential Skills and Experience 
  • DevOps/infrastructure experience in production environments 
  • Strong Kubernetes knowledge including deployment, scaling, networking, and troubleshooting 
  • Experience with infrastructure as code and cloud resource management 
  • Azure cloud experience including AKS, networking, storage, and security services 
  • CI/CD pipeline experience with GitOps tools (ArgoCD preferred) or similar platforms 
  • Scripting and automation using Bash, Python, or similar languages 
  • Monitoring and observability tools experience (Prometheus, Grafana, or similar) 
  • Problem-solving skills - ability to troubleshoot complex distributed systems 
Desirable Skills and Experience 
  • Experience with GitHub Actions for CI/CD 
  • Understanding of networking and load balancing in cloud environments 
  • Security tooling experience - vulnerability scanning, SAST/DAST, compliance automation 
  • Experience with cost optimization and FinOps practices in cloud environments 
  • Knowledge of database administration – MS SQL, PostgreSQL, Redis, or similar 
  • Understanding of AI/ML infrastructure requirements  
  • Experience in B2B SaaS  
  • Disaster recovery and business continuity planning experience 
  • Experience with log aggregation tools like ELK stack or similar 
What Makes You a Great Fit 
  • Learning Mindset: You're excited to learn new tools and practices, staying current with modern DevOps approaches and emerging technologies. 
  • Systems Thinking: You understand how distributed systems work and can reason about failure modes, bottlenecks, and reliability patterns. 
  • Pragmatic Approach: You balance perfect solutions with shipping value quickly. You know when to automate and when to move fast manually. 
  • Collaboration: You work well with engineering teams, understanding their needs and enabling their productivity without slowing them down. 
  • Ownership: You take responsibility for the reliability and performance of systems you build. You follow through on incidents and improvements. 
  • Proactive Mindset: You spot opportunities for automation and improvement. You bring energy, optimism, and a can-do attitude to infrastructure challenges. 
  • Security Conscious: You treat security and compliance as first-class concerns in everything you build and deploy. 
  • Automation First: You believe in automating repetitive tasks and building self-service capabilities for teams. 

Benefits

What will you get?  
  • Competitive salary  
  • Performance based bonus 
  • 25 days annual leave  
  • Health Insurance  
  • Company pension  
  • Company events  
  • free food onsite  
  • On-site parking  
  • Referral programme  
  • Sick pay  
  • Wellness programmes 
Apply Now

Other home office and work from home jobs